Pakistan Preview
Pakistan will be more than happy, as Babar Azam is back in form and has scored a century. It would take a big load from their back. Pakistan won the first two games and have already won the series now. They will look to close it with a 3-0 margin. Shaheen Afridi missed the last game, and he might be back for the final game.
- Key Batter: Babar Azam and Fakhar Zaman were stars with the bat in the last game and will be the ones to watch out for.
- Captaincy: Captain Shaheen Afridi will be back, and he is Pakistan’s premier wicket-taker. If Salman Agha will captain, then he is also in great form.
- Batting Strength: In-form Babar Azam makes the Pakistani side a very strong team. He looked short of confidence, but his century must have filled him with confidence. Fakhar Zaman also scored runs, and he is an aggressive batter. Saim Ayub and Salman Agha are also in good form, and then they have several good all-rounders.
- Bowling Attack: Abrar Ahmed’s inclusion in the playing XI changed the whole look for the Pakistani bowling unit. He missed the first game, which was a surprise. But he is a wicket-taker. Naseem Shah has been in good form as well, and they all are bowling better than Sri Lanka.
Sri Lanka Preview
Sri Lanka have been below par with the ball in hand. That has put them on the receiving end in both games. They charge with the bat and then lose the momentum, which has been the pattern in two matches. Can Sri Lanka end the ODI series with something special?
- Batting: The batting has been decent for Sri Lanka. They have managed to score 285 or more in both matches. But like Pakistan, they need someone to play a big innings or score a century, which can help them.
- Bowling: The bowling has been a problem for Sri Lanka. They have only taken seven wickets in two games, which has been disappointing for the team and fans. Hasaranga is the only bowler who has looked good. Others also need to step up and contribute.

Rawalpindi Cricket Stadium Pitch and Weather Report
The first two matches at Rawalpindi Cricket Stadium have been high scoring. In all four ODIs, the score has crossed 285. So, we can expect another good scoring game here. This venue has hosted a total of 29 ODIs so far. 12 matches have been won batting first, and the other 16 matches have won by the chasing side and have an average first-inning score of 245.
The weather conditions for the third and final ODI will be clear. The temperature will be around 24°C–26°C, with the humidity expected to be around 30 and 40 percent.
